Class ObjectTrackingProcessor
java.lang.Object
com.azure.media.videoanalyzer.edge.models.ProcessorNodeBase
com.azure.media.videoanalyzer.edge.models.ObjectTrackingProcessor
Object tracker processor allows for continuous tracking of one of more objects over a finite sequence of video
frames. It must be used downstream of an object detector extension node, thus allowing for the extension to be
configured to to perform inferences on sparse frames through the use of the 'maximumSamplesPerSecond' sampling
property. The object tracker node will then track the detected objects over the frames in which the detector is not
invoked resulting on a smother tracking of detected objects across the continuum of video frames. The tracker will
stop tracking objects which are not subsequently detected by the upstream detector on the subsequent detections.

Method Details
-
getAccuracy
Get the accuracy property: Object tracker accuracy: low, medium, high. Higher accuracy leads to higher CPU consumption in average.- Returns:
- the accuracy value.
-
setAccuracy
Set the accuracy property: Object tracker accuracy: low, medium, high. Higher accuracy leads to higher CPU consumption in average.- Parameters:
accuracy
- the accuracy value to set.- Returns:
- the ObjectTrackingProcessor object itself.
